    It was clean, the little double bed was comfortable, and the shower works.

    Very disappointing and way overpriced. Ours was a non-refundable booking, or I definitely would have stayed elsewhere. Yes, it's an historic building with charm, but our room was tiny, way smaller than the photos show. It was also hot, without any airflow, aircon or fridge, though a pedestal fan made it less stuffy..Luckily the weather was cooler on the second night. The cool downstairs dining and lounge areas are locked outside of breakfast or dinner hours, the outdoor area is in full sun, so there is nowhere at all to sit. We had to take our food to a public park! We have been travelling around Spain for four months now, and this was double priced to every other rural accommodation, often apartments with kitchens. I must have been very tired when I booked this, thinking it was €80 for both nights.

    Stunning building dating back to 13c which has been sympathetically restored and turned into a hotel. So much character but with all the modern conveniences. Our room was fabulous and such a comfy bed. We had an evening meal which was freshly prepared with the best ingredients and amazing value for money. Nothing not to like.

    Everything. Location, ambiance, cleanliness, food and service all exemplary. Nothing was too much trouble and despite linguistic differences Suzanna managed to make herself understood and to understand us. If you're in the area and going to be within an hour of this place and needing a place to stay then book it. You will not be disappointed. Location-wise it feels like you are in a little village but it's actually just a small part of a much larger town. Full of charm with steep little cobbled streets and trees in the plaza.

    Nothing. It's a bit off the beaten track but if you want value for money you won't beat it.
